German photographer Florian Krause dropped this video documenting the process behind capturing his latest shot, which showcases pieces by Rake Case & Kent. Kruase uses only tools of light and his camera to capture these dope shots, which have no post-processing editing or Photoshop manipulations. He strategically shines and moves light across his subjects during long exposures to create these shots that otherwise don’t exist in the dark.
